Fleming and Felicity Huntingford 10.1 Introduction 286 10.2 Mechanisms 291 10.3 Development 295 10.4 Functions 297 10.5 Implications for aquaculture 302 10.6 Solutions 310 10.7 Synopsis 314 11 Conclusions: Aquaculture and Behaviour 322 Felicity Huntingford, Malcolm Jobling and Sunil Kadri 11.1 The relevance of behaviour in current aquaculture systems 322 11.2 The relevance of behaviour in future aquaculture systems 327 Index 333ReviewsAuthor InformationFelicity Huntingford is Emeritus Professor of Functional Ecology, College of Medical, Veterinary & Life Sciences, University of Glasgow. Malcolm Jobling is Professor of Aquaculture at BFE, University of Tromsø, Norway. Sunil Kadri is an Honorary Research Fellow at the University of Glasgow, UK and Director of OptoSwim Technologies Ltd., UK, Europharma Scotland Ltd. UK & AQ1 Systems Ltd., Australia.
